Output abba38be1eebd7b165d39bb41a10aec8da4b60fa207d51f00e47d95e6b019029:1

value
84232
script pubkey
OP_0 OP_PUSHBYTES_20 77b40c816470c6175bf016b324cace16b0d94144
address
bc1qw76qeqtywrrpwklsz6ejfjkwz6cdjs2yv4nudd
transaction
abba38be1eebd7b165d39bb41a10aec8da4b60fa207d51f00e47d95e6b019029
confirmations
42967
spent
true